wangjianyu3 7e53ba18f8 arch/arm/rp2040: fix IN endpoint DPSRAM index for bare-eplog callers
rp2040_allocep() indexes the endpoint's DPSRAM buffer/control
registers via RP2040_DPINDEX(eplog) and RP2040_EPINDEX(eplog), both
of which take the transfer direction from the direction bit of
'eplog' itself instead of trusting the explicit 'in' argument that
is also passed to this function.

This is harmless for callers that always encode the direction bit
into 'eplog' (e.g. CDC/ACM's CDCACM_MKEPBULKIN()/MKEPINTIN(), which
OR in USB_DIR_IN), since 'in' then always agrees with that bit.  But
drivers/usbdev/usbdev_fs.c (the generic ADB/fastboot class driver)
calls DEV_ALLOCEP() with a bare endpoint number in 'eplog' (no
direction bit) and passes the direction only via the separate 'in'
parameter - matching this function's own "direction bit ignored"
contract for 'eplog' (see its Input Parameters doc, and the
pre-existing "Ignore any direction bits in the logical address"
comment, both dating back to the original driver in b860e3c4ad).
For such a bare-number IN endpoint, USB_ISEPOUT(eplog) always
evaluates true (the IN bit is never set on a plain number), so
RP2040_DPINDEX(eplog) silently pointed the endpoint's buffer/control
registers at its OUT slot instead of its IN slot.  The real IN slot
was left unconfigured, so the SIE responded to every IN token on
that endpoint with a STALL - confirmed on real hardware via usbmon:
'C Bi:1:050:6 -32 0' (EPIPE) on every attempt, while the paired OUT
endpoint (which "accidentally" resolved to the correct slot for the
same reason) worked fine.

Fix: normalize 'eplog' to agree with the explicit 'in' argument
before it is used by RP2040_EPINDEX()/RP2040_DPINDEX(), so both
macros keep their original, single-argument form and every use of
eplog's direction bit below this point is consistent with 'in'.
Existing 0x80-encoded callers (EP0, CDC/ACM) already agree with 'in'
and are unaffected by the normalization.

Also fix two pre-existing nxstyle violations in this same file
(a misaligned comment block under USB_REQ_SYNCHFRAME, and a bare
';' body instead of empty braces on a while loop), both dating back
to the original driver in b860e3c4ad as well; CI runs nxstyle on
the whole file whenever it is touched.

Apache NuttX is a real-time operating system (RTOS) with an emphasis on standards compliance and small footprint. Scalable from 8-bit to 64-bit microcontroller environments, the primary governing standards in NuttX are POSIX and ANSI standards. Additional standard APIs from Unix and other common RTOSs (such as VxWorks) are adopted for functionality not available under these standards, or for functionality that is not appropriate for deeply-embedded environments (such as fork()).
